WebOct 26, 2024 · For performance analysis scenarios to work, you will need access to the symbols that correlate with the Windows application being tested. When building with Visual Studio, they will be located the same as in the debugging scenario settings, either built with your solution or captured from symbol servers. Click on Advanced Options in the lower left corner of the window and you should see … WebNov 19, 2024 · Like on an Azure App Service. You can use WinDbg to find the threads that hold the lock. Use the !threads command first to see all threads and Lock Count. Then, move to the thread with a lock count higher than 0 with ~ [native_thread_id]s. For example, ~3s. Then, use !clrstack to view its call stack. don mann seal team six books in order

WebJul 11, 2013 · Decompilers such as IDA load symbol files when it analyses your executable, or when you tell it to load specific symbols with your executable, as long as it matches the executable currently being debugged. Debuggers such as the Visual Studio debugger load PDB files and symbols as soon as it starts debugging, not when an exception occurs.
